How A Bainbridge Septic System Works

From Toilet To Tank To Drainfield

After flushing a toilet the liquids and solids travel down a pipes line into the septic tank. The septic tank is a vault, which traps solid waste and enables clear liquid to flow through to the drainfield. Inside the septic tank solids and liquids different into 3 layers. The leading layer is called the residue layer it consists of floatables including: fats, oils, grease, soaps, and phosphates. The middle layer is the bottom layer and the liquid layer is the sludge layer. The sludge layer consists of heavy particles of organic matter which breakdown through an anaerobic procedure. The clear water exits the tank through an outlet baffle and is dispersed into the drainfield which soaks up the water.
